Equine abortion virus (EAV)-induced hepatitis in hamsters presents an interesting animal model for the evaluation of drugs possessing anti-deoxyribonucleic acid virus activity. These experiments demonstrate that 9-beta-d-arabinofuranosylhypoxanthine 5'-monophosphate (ara-HxMP), a new synthetic, water-soluble, antiviral agent, effectively controls this disease in hamsters with a therapeutic index of approximately 60. Ara-HxMP prevented hepatitis-associated deaths in hamsters, reduced the titer of EAV developing in hamsters, and inhibited the increase of serum glutamic pyruvic transaminase in EAV-infected hamsters.
